Web12 Nov 2024 · This bone is the smallest component of the hip bone. It is divided into three main parts: body, superior ramus, and inferior ramus. What muscles attach to pubic Ramus? Attachments. gracilis muscle and adductor brevis muscle at the external surface of the body of pubis and its inferior ramus. obturator externus muscle and obturator internus muscle.
